package android.content;

import android.test.AndroidTestCase;

import androidx.test.filters.SmallTest;

/** Test to make sure brick intents <b>don't</b> work without permission. */
public class BrickDeniedTest extends AndroidTestCase {
    @SmallTest
    public void testBrick() {
        // Try both the old and new brick intent names.  Neither should work,
        // since this test application doesn't have the required permission.
        // If it does work, well, the test certainly won't pass.
        getContext().sendBroadcast(new Intent("SHES_A_BRICK_HOUSE"));
        getContext().sendBroadcast(new Intent("android.intent.action.BRICK"));
    }
}

package com.android.server;

import android.content.Context;
import android.content.Intent;
import android.content.BroadcastReceiver;
import android.os.SystemService;
import android.util.Slog;

public class BrickReceiver extends BroadcastReceiver {
    @Override
    public void onReceive(Context context, Intent intent) {
        Slog.w("BrickReceiver", "!!! BRICKING DEVICE !!!");
        SystemService.start("brick");
    }
}
